What Happens When You Drop In

Most arcade games reward speed. This one punishes it. 3D Helix Jump Ball places a sphere at the top of a spiraling tower and asks one simple question: can you reach the bottom without touching a black segment? The answer, at least early on, is rarely yes. The game rotates the helix left or right as your ball falls, and every rotation either opens a safe gap or sends you straight into a fail zone.

The action is continuous but controlled. You are not racing a timer. You are managing a descent, and that distinction changes everything about how the game feels.

The Core Mechanic: Rotation and Timing

The helix tower is made of stacked circular platforms, each divided into colored segments and black danger zones. Rotating the structure shifts which segment sits beneath your falling ball. The goal is to always keep a colored segment under the sphere so it breaks through cleanly on the way down.

What the Black Segments Do

Black sections end the run immediately. There is no health bar, no second chance. One contact and the ball resets to the top of the tower. This makes every rotation decision feel meaningful, especially when the gap between a safe segment and a black one is just a fraction of a turn.

Breaking Through vs. Falling Through

There is a difference between landing on a platform and punching through it. When the ball hits a colored segment with enough momentum, it breaks through with a satisfying crunch sound and visual shatter effect. Falling through an open gap feels different — faster, riskier, and more rewarding when timed correctly. Learning to distinguish when to break and when to drop through existing gaps is part of what makes the game increasingly strategic at higher levels.

How Difficulty Builds Across Levels

Early levels are forgiving. The black zones are sparse, and the safe segments are wide enough to land without precise rotation. As levels progress, the layout tightens considerably. Gaps become narrower, black zones cluster together, and some platforms rotate or shift in ways that require anticipating movement rather than reacting to it.

By mid-game, a single level can have multiple consecutive platforms where the safe path requires a specific sequence of rotations executed in quick succession. One mistimed input cascades into failure within two or three platforms. The game never announces this difficulty spike — it just arrives.

Visual Design and Feedback

The color palette is bold and high-contrast, which helps distinguish safe zones from danger zones at a glance. The fluid motion of the tower as it rotates adds a slightly hypnotic quality to long descent runs. When things go well, the rhythm of breaking through platform after platform creates a flow state that makes losing feel surprising rather than frustrating.

Sound design reinforces this. The crunch of a broken platform and the sharp stop of a failed run both register clearly, giving the player immediate audio feedback without needing to read anything on screen.

Strategy Tips for Longer Runs

  • Look two or three platforms ahead rather than focusing only on the one directly below.
  • Rotate in small increments when near a black segment — overshooting is the most common mistake.
